VSS provides coordination between these parties: Our design is focused on the scenario where the requestor is a backup application. Requestors initiate the creation and destruction of shadow copies.Writers are applications that change data and participate in the shadow copy synchronization process.Providers own the shadow copy data and instantiate the shadow copies. VSS coordinates the activities of the following cooperating components: The VSS service starts on demand therefore, for VSS operations to be successful, this service must be enabled. Implements the low-level driver functionality necessary for any provider to work.Coordinates activities of providers, writers, and requestors in the creation and use of shadow copies.Though largely transparent to both user and developer, VSS: VSS provides the system infrastructure for running VSS applications on Windows systems. It also captures details on how to configure and use the SQL writer to work with backup applications in the VSS framework. This paper describes the SQL writer component and its role in the VSS snapshot creation and restores process for SQL Server databases. SQL Server provides support for Volume Shadow Copy Service (VSS) by providing a writer (the SQL writer) so that a third-party backup application can use the VSS framework to back up database files.
